Three GCC Members head to World Senior Championships

From April 20-27, three Granite Curling Club members will compete in the World Curling Senior National Championships in Östersund, Sweden.

Darren Lehto was asked to join Team Farbelow, the winners of the 2024 USA Curling Senior Men's Championship. He has competed against and with everyone on the team before, and he looks forward to representing the USA again on the Senior Worlds stage. Chad Johnson was asked to represent the Nigeria Curling Federation at the Senior Worlds Championships. He looks forward to taking this opportunity to represent his ancestral land as well as promote curling to a group of people who are underrepresented. Peter Garbes is curling with Team Philippines (Curling Winter Sports Association of the Philippines). This marks the historic debut of a Philippine team at a Senior Worlds curling event, and it's a step closer to full WCF membership for the association. Good curling to all three teams!

Team Yalowicki Wins Berth to Mixed Nationals

Cory Yalowicki, Shelby Williams, Jordan Williams, and Aryn Grause won the PNWCA Mixed Playdown hosted by Evergreen Curling Club in January. They are representing the region at USA Curling Mixed Nationals from April 10-14 at Denver Curling Club.

Team Rauliuk takes 4th at Women's Senior Nationals

At the Senior Women's National Championship, Lisa Rauliuk, Lori Markham, Jiyoung Lee, and a curler from the east coast finished the round robin tied for second place with a 5-2 record. They ended the event with a 4th place finish, a strong showing for GCC.
